    Took my pregnat wife that doesn't fish much this morning. Wanted to put her on a lot of fish, so put in at Long Shoal and fished up the grand. Caught our limits, dressed fish, and ate lunch at the marina before it got too hot. One of the funnest days fishing in a while. Should have caught another limit for the baby on the way, but I don't think that would go over well with the water patrol.

    Twenty fow, 12 foot down, all on minnows, more on hardwoods, better ones on cedars. Nothing over 11 inches, but caught a lot of fish.
